]> git.immae.eu Git - github/Chocobozzz/PeerTube.git/blobdiff - client/src/app/+admin/config/edit-custom-config/edit-configuration.service.ts
Improve remote runner config UX
[github/Chocobozzz/PeerTube.git] / client / src / app / +admin / config / edit-custom-config / edit-configuration.service.ts
index 96f5b830e964a45a8d59461985b73a91583dcdf3..628c2d10268a6af664017211ec5486275aabb6ba 100644 (file)
@@ -61,6 +61,18 @@ export class EditConfigurationService {
     return form.value['transcoding']['enabled'] === true
   }
 
+  isRemoteRunnerVODEnabled (form: FormGroup) {
+    return form.value['transcoding']['remoteRunners']['enabled'] === true
+  }
+
+  isRemoteRunnerLiveEnabled (form: FormGroup) {
+    return form.value['live']['transcoding']['remoteRunners']['enabled'] === true
+  }
+
+  isStudioEnabled (form: FormGroup) {
+    return form.value['videoStudio']['enabled'] === true
+  }
+
   isLiveEnabled (form: FormGroup) {
     return form.value['live']['enabled'] === true
   }